Despite having no recording experience, it took her only three or four minutes to hook things up and figure out how to record. To test that, I laid a dynamic mic, an XLR cable, some headphones and the RodeCaster Pro before my eight-year-old daughter and challenged her to plug things in and record something. Rode have thought really hard about the market for this product, which extends well beyond the typical audio engineer or self-recording musician, and have designed it to be easy for anyone to use. But using the RodeCaster Pro is a very different experience from using a typical digital mixer. For example, there's wired and wireless smartphone connectivity, digital multitrack recording over USB or direct to a microSD card, and a built-in sampler with trigger pads for sound effects. In essence, the RodeCaster Pro is a digital mixer with some facilities aimed squarely at the podcast community. The hardware remains the same but firmware upgrades have extended the functionality considerably. Regular readers may be experiencing deja vu at this point, so I should explain that we appraised an earlier version back in SOS April 2019 issue. ![]() This is where Rode's RodeCaster Pro comes in. If you cater for each need as it arises, the costs can escalate and setting up can grow complex. You might also want to integrate contributors over the phone or on video calls. With different voices, different mics and sampled sounds, you probably want a mixer, so you can easily adjust the balance on the fly. If you plan on producing radio-style shows, you might want a way to trigger sound effects as you go of course, you could add such things in post-production, but it takes time and you don't capture the reaction of your guests. For example, when recording multiple people in the same room, you'll need mics, an interface with sufficient preamps, and a headphone out and preferably a level control for each participant. ![]() The simplest podcast may require little more than a USB mic and a computer, but some projects demand more in terms of gear.
